ITS is currently hiring for the Spring 2006 semester. We are looking for enthusiastic, technology-minded students who are eager to help support the campus computing environment. Some of our positions are extremely technical others less so. Field Service Techs install video cards and remove spyware; Trainers teach workshops on software from Excel to Dreamweaver; Helpdesk Specialists troubleshoot problems for faculty and staff and our student designers do print and web publishing.
You don't have to be a computer science major to work for us. If you want to learn, we'll teach you everything you need to know.
